## Summary

Comparing JavaScript frameworks to Laravel for web development. Discusses the lack of a Laravel-like framework in the JavaScript ecosystem. Highlights the benefits of JavaScript frameworks and libraries, as well as the advantages of using Laravel. Provides a comparison between JavaScript frameworks and Laravel in terms of features, flexibility, salary, availability of tools, security, documentation, testing & debugging, learning curve, scalability, deployment & hosting, customization, performance, and future prospects.
